Bitcoin ought to be valued as “an uncorrelated asset that advantages when the world will get messier,” BlackRock’s US Head of Fairness ETFs Jay Jacobs instructed CNBC in an interview on Thursday.

“Crypto over the long term is decoupled from US tech shares,” Jacobs stated, stressing that short-term market stress can masks the distinction however that “the long-term correlation between US shares and Bitcoin is extra like two or three %.” He argued that what pushes equities increased—“increased development, increased certainty, decrease geopolitical danger”—is the mirror picture of the forces that transfer Bitcoin. “Bitcoin thrives when you have got extra uncertainty and are on the lookout for one thing that’s going to behave in another way, so essentially they need to behave like an uncorrelated asset.”

BTC was altering arms just below $94,000 throughout Jacobs’ look, extending a rally that has added roughly 150% since spot-ETF approvals early final 12 months.

Bitcoin Rises As a result of Of ‘Mega-Forces”

Jacobs tied value behaviour on to flows. “We might assume over the long run, if this trajectory of better uncertainty all over the world continues, issues like gold and Bitcoin ought to proceed to go up.” He famous that buyers are repositioning accordingly: “We’ve seen vital inflows into gold ETFs; we’ve seen vital inflows into Bitcoin, and that is all as a result of persons are on the lookout for these property that may behave in another way.”

The largest beneficiary has been BlackRock’s personal iShares Bitcoin Belief (IBIT), which on 23 April absorbed $643 million of web creations—its largest one-day haul since January—lifting the fund’s property to roughly $54 billion.

Jacobs framed the frenzy into arduous property as a part of an extended geopolitical realignment. “For those who have a look at central banks all over the world, a continued motion in the direction of diversification past simply holding {dollars} is one thing that’s been taking place for many years… the swap from simply holding {dollars} to holding gold to taking a look at different sorts of property like Bitcoin is a pattern that’s been years within the making.”

Central-bank gold purchases illustrate the shift: web shopping for topped 1,044 tonnes in 2024, the third consecutive 12 months above the thousand-tonne mark, double the typical of the earlier decade.

He linked these reserve strikes to BlackRock’s 2023 “mega-forces” framework, which recognized geopolitical fragmentation as a secular driver of returns. “That mega pressure is materialising in insurance policies like reshoring in the US and, I believe, instantly associated to that fragmentation has been the rise of issues like Bitcoin, as individuals see extra destabilisation in geopolitics ensuing within the want for extra different property.”

BlackRock’s affect is tough to overstate: the agency ended the primary quarter with a file $11.6 trillion below administration.

By pairing that scale with a public thesis that Bitcoin’s honest value rises as uncertainty deepens, the asset-manager is successfully codifying a valuation mannequin through which shortage and sanction-resistance—not discounted money flows—set the marginal value.

As Jacobs put it, the market is “on the lookout for alternate options—components of the portfolio which might be going to behave individually from shares and bonds.” With IBIT now swallowing extra BTC every day than miners can produce post-halving, his remarks might supply the clearest blueprint but for the way the world’s largest asset supervisor thinks about pricing the world’s largest cryptocurrency.

At press time, BTC traded at $94,510.
